在现代网络浏览器的使用中,缓存是一种常见的技术,它帮助加快网页加载速度,提高用户体验。然而,有些类型的缓存数据即使尝试删除,也可能无法被清除。以下是几种常见的无法删除的缓存类型及其原因:
1. 第三方缓存
类型:由第三方脚本或广告服务提供商设置的缓存。
原因:这类缓存通常是为了跟踪用户行为、展示个性化广告或优化服务。由于它们不是由用户直接控制的,因此浏览器可能无法提供删除这些缓存的方法。
示例:某些网站上的广告或分析工具可能会在用户浏览器中设置缓存。
2. 系统缓存
类型:浏览器在操作系统层面进行的缓存。
原因:系统缓存是为了提高整体系统性能而设置的,它可能包括浏览器缓存的一部分,但由于它是在系统层面进行的,所以用户层面的浏览器设置可能无法触及。
示例:在某些操作系统中,浏览器缓存文件可能会被系统自动清理,而用户无法直接干预。
3. 隐私保护缓存
类型:一些浏览器为了保护用户隐私而自动保留的缓存。
原因:为了防止用户在删除缓存时意外丢失重要数据,一些浏览器可能会自动保留某些缓存,如历史记录、书签等。
示例:Chrome 浏览器可能会保留用户的历史记录,即使清除了其他缓存。
4. 预加载缓存
类型:浏览器为了预测用户可能访问的页面而自动预加载的缓存。
原因:预加载缓存旨在提高页面访问速度,减少等待时间。由于它是基于浏览器的算法自动进行的,用户可能无法直接控制或删除。
示例:当用户浏览一个网站时,浏览器可能会自动预加载该网站的其他页面。
5. 隐蔽的缓存
类型:一些网站或服务可能使用了隐蔽的缓存技术,这些缓存对用户不可见。
原因:为了实现特定的功能或服务,某些缓存可能被设计成对用户隐藏,因此用户无法直接访问或删除。
示例:某些网站可能使用JavaScript来设置隐藏的缓存,这些缓存可能用于跟踪用户行为或实现特定功能。
解决方法
尽管这些缓存类型可能无法通过常规的浏览器清除缓存功能删除,但以下方法可能有所帮助:
- 更新浏览器:确保使用最新版本的浏览器,因为新版本可能包含改进的缓存管理功能。
- 重置浏览器设置:在某些情况下,重置浏览器设置可能有助于清除一些无法删除的缓存。
- 操作系统清理:在某些操作系统中,可能需要通过系统清理工具来处理缓存问题。
- 联系网站管理员:如果缓存问题严重影响了用户体验,可以尝试联系网站管理员寻求帮助。
总之,浏览器不能删除的缓存类型通常是由于技术实现或隐私保护的原因造成的。了解这些原因有助于用户更好地管理自己的浏览器缓存。
